Elipheleh served as a gatekeeper and musician under King David, specifically noted for his role in the musical accompaniment during the transport of the Ark of the Covenant.

SIGNIFICANCE
His inclusion in the biblical record demonstrates the formalization of Levitical duties and the integration of musical performance into the liturgical movement of sacred objects in ancient Israel.
